From the Hugging Face Hub to robot hardware with Strands Agents and LeRobot
Hugging Face has released a library called LeRobot to help developers train AI agents for physical robotic tasks. This toolkit provides pre-trained models and datasets designed to simplify the process of teaching robots to navigate environments or manipulate objects. By offering standardized tools for robot control, the project aims to lower the barrier for integrating machine learning into hardware. This initiative follows the company's broader push to expand its open-source infrastructure from digital applications into the physical robotics space.
